Patent number: 11326036Abstract: A phenolic resin foam has a density of 30 kg/m3 to 80 kg/m3, a closed cell ratio of 85% or more, and reaches a total amount of heat release of 8 MJ/m2 in a time of 20 minutes or more in a heat release test performed using a cone calorimeter.Type: GrantFiled: April 26, 2019Date of Patent: May 10, 2022Assignee: Asahi Kasei Construction Materials CorporationInventors: Hisashi Mihori, Noriaki Kikuchi, Masami Komiyama

Patent number: 7231854Abstract: To provide a connected-screw driver capable of stably retaining a screw, which has just come off from a screw connecting belt, and constantly tightening the resultant screw in a tightening position. A connected-screw driver having a driver unit provided with a motor, an output shaft, a housing, and a bit mounted to the output shaft, a slider case mounted to the housing to permit the bit to be inserted therethrough, and a slider 7 provided in the slider case to be able to reciprocate therein and having an engagement member 20a adapted to abut against a member being tightened, the slider feeding connected screws as the slider reciprocates, and wherein the slider 7 is provided with a chuck mechanism 18 that is movable in an axial direction of the bit and temporarily retains a screw, which has come off from a screw connecting belt, until the screw abuts against a member being tightened, and a regulating mechanism 19 that regulates and fixes a position of the chuck mechanism 18 in the axial direction of the bit.Type: GrantFiled: April 27, 2006Date of Patent: June 19, 2007Assignee: Hitachi Koki Co., Ltd.Inventor: Noriaki Kikuchi

Patent number: 7165481Abstract: A screwdriver includes a driver portion, a slider case having a guide slot, a slider (7), comprising parts (7A) and (7B) reciprocating, in the slider case, an arm portion comprising shaft arm (16) and clutch arm that is supported and rotates in the slider (7), engaged with the guide slot of the slider case, and oscillates in accordance with the reciprocation of the slider, and a cylindrical drum that is supported and rotates in the slider, has two flanges (11b) and (11c) engaged with a screw chain belt and a ratchet (11e) engaged with the arm portion, and intermittently delivers the screw chain belt in accordance with the oscillation of the arm portion. The ratchet (11e) of the drum (11) is formed on an inner surface of the flange (11b).Type: GrantFiled: April 27, 2006Date of Patent: January 23, 2007Assignee: Hitachi Koki Co., Ltd.Inventor: Noriaki Kikuchi

Patent number: 6668690Abstract: A longer life screwdriver is disclosed, and the screwdriver includes a ball retained in a through-hole in a manner movable in a radial direction of a driving shaft member, the through-hole being defined in a driving shaft member, the ball being possible to project beyond the driving shaft member along an outer circumference of the driving shaft member, the ball further being possible to abut an end of a clutch spring, and elements for allowing the ball to protrude beyond the driving shaft member along the outer circumference of the driving shaft member in response to axial movement of the output shaft member against a pressing member, the improvement comprising: disengagement elements for releasing engagement between the clutch spring and the ball during the reverse rotation of a motor.Type: GrantFiled: May 6, 2002Date of Patent: December 30, 2003Assignee: Hitachi Koki Co., Ltd.Inventors: Noriaki Kikuchi, Hajime Kikuchi, Masateru Niyada

Patent number: 6627229Abstract: An antiviral agent of an antiviral ability against various viruses and a method of producing the same are provided. A heat treatment is applied to a calcium-containing substance represented by calcium carbonate-containing substances originating from the animal such as clamshell, eggshell, crustacean shell, bone, coral, and pearl, and calcium carbonate-containing minerals such as limestone. When a temperature of the heat treatment is not less than 650° C. and less than a melting point of the calcium component-containing substance, a sufficient time of the heat treatment is 2 to 13 hours.Type: GrantFiled: June 23, 2001Date of Patent: September 30, 2003Inventors: Kazutomo Kikuchi, Noriaki Kikuchi

Patent number: 6573594Abstract: A BGA semiconductor device using an insulating film and having air purge holes situated between metal through-holes in a base film serving as a substrate Stagnant air can be purged from voids formed between the insulating film arranged on the upper face of a wiring pattern on the base film and the wiring pattern via the air purge holes before electronic elements formed with chip bonding are packaged with asealing resin.Type: GrantFiled: August 8, 2001Date of Patent: June 3, 2003Assignee: Rohm Co., Ltd.Inventor: Noriaki Kikuchi
